WEB开发网
开发学院手机开发Android 开发 Android Activity 切换示例 阅读

Android Activity 切换示例

 2010-03-19 07:17:00 来源:WEB开发网   
核心提示:Activity1:package com.sample.android.activitytransition;import android.app.Activity;import android.os.Bundle;import android.widget.*;import android.content.*;im

Activity1:

package com.sample.android.activitytransition;

import android.app.Activity;

import android.os.Bundle;

import android.widget.*;

import android.content.*;

import android.view.*;

public class Activity1 extends Activity {

/** Called when the activity is first created. */

@Override

public void onCreate(Bundle savedInstanceState) {

super.onCreate(savedInstanceState);

setContentView(R.layout.activity1);

Button button = (Button)findViewById(R.id.button1);

button.setOnClickListener(new Button.OnClickListener(){

@Override

public void onClick(View v) {

Intent intent = new Intent();

intent.setClass(Activity1.this, Activity2.class);

startActivity(intent);

Activity1.this.finish();

}

});

}

}

Activity 2:

package com.sample.android.activitytransition;

import android.app.Activity;

import android.content.Intent;

import android.os.Bundle;

import android.view.View;

import android.widget.Button;

public class Activity2 extends Activity {

public void onCreate(Bundle savedInstanceState)

{

super.onCreate(savedInstanceState);

setContentView(R.layout.activity2);

Button button = (Button) findViewById(R.id.button2);

button.setOnClickListener(new Button.OnClickListener(){

@Override

public void onClick(View v) {

Intent intent = new Intent();

intent.setClass(Activity2.this, Activity1.class);

startActivity(intent);

Activity2.this.finish();

}

});

}

}

Tags:Android Activity 切换

编辑录入:coldstar [复制链接] [打 印]
赞助商链接